Role Summary
As Manager, Capital Markets Finance, you will play an integral role at Rowan analyzing development projects, modeling financial projections and securing financing for Rowan’s portfolio. This role will support the CFO and Head of Capital Markets by building business cases, analyzing investment returns, working with commercial teams on lease structure the execution of capital raise transactions, interfacing with banks and financial institutions, and working with both internal and external stakeholders from pre-launch to closing for our growing project pipeline. We have completed over $3.4 billion of financing transactions in less than 2 years and expect this volume to continue for several years.

Essential Responsibilities
- Build complex discounted cash flow models
- Support capital raise transactions, including equity and debt
- Support all phases of the project financial lifecycle, from pre-launch to closing and operations
- Conduct preliminary due diligence to identify and mitigate risks
- Coordinate due diligence and documentation with capital providers
- Evaluate current and potential financing opportunities through forecasting cash flows, tax impacts, and investor returns
- Maintain strong relationships with equity investors, lenders, other relevant consultants and advisors
